The BenQ E72 is a 2007 Microsoft Windows Mobile 6.0 device powered by the TI OMAP V1030 with 64MB and 128MB internal storage. It features a 2.0", TFT, 65K colors, 240.0x320.0 display and is available in Bright red.

The E72 is equipped with a Removable Li-Ion 900 mAh battery, a 2 MP, Yes main camera. The device uses a Mini-SIM configuration. It weighs 90 g.

On this device this is just a forced restart/power-cycle — it does not erase data by itself. See Factory Reset for the data-erasing option.

1

Windows Mobile devices generally don't have a hardware button combination that wipes data the way Android's Recovery Mode does

2

The closest equivalent is the in-menu Factory Reset described in the Factory Reset guide below

3

If the device is completely frozen and won't respond to the Factory Reset menu, remove the battery for 30 seconds (if removable) to force a restart, then try again

4

Exact steps vary by exact model and firmware version — check the printed manual or the manufacturer's support site if these don't match your device
